內循環 - LTE系統中FFT的實現

?
按時間抽取法的FFT輸入序列是倒序,輸出序列是自然順序;按頻率抽取法的FFT輸入序列是自然順序,輸出序列是倒序的。不管采用哪種方法進行FFT計算,都需要倒序處理。倒序是整個FFT計算的重要部分,進行匯編程序時,按自然順序將輸入數據存入到存儲單元內,通過變址運算,將自然順序的序列按時間抽取法要求進行倒位。
重新排序之前,存儲單元Y中依次存放輸入數據,I表示當前輸入數據比特的順序數的十進制數值,I的取值從0到N-I;J表示當前倒序數的十進制數值。輸入序列的第一個和最后一個數的位置不需要倒序處理,完成倒序的外循環的次數為N-2。為了保證調換數據的正確性,需要檢測一下是否I
?
3 性能分析與總結
在DSP軟件實現中,通過指令并行,盡量優化程序循環體,減少或消除程序中的’NOP’指令[6]。通過程序仿真運行,得到統計結果如表1所示。
?
從表中可以看出,當運用TMS320C64×DSP芯片實現時,由于處理器的超高主頻一般為1GHz,一個指令周期耗時為1ns,其運算速率非常快,完全可以滿足實時性信號處理。因此,采用旋轉因子查表法的實現方案不僅簡化了程序實現方法,還減少了模塊程序代碼編寫,節約了系統存儲空間。
本文提出了一種簡單有效的FFT算法實現方案,詳細介紹了算法在DSP的實現方法,并在TMS320C64x芯片上加以實現。程序運行結果表明,該算法能夠滿足TD-LTE系統的需求,具有可行性和高效性。該方案已應用于LTE-TDD無線綜合測試儀表的開發中。
- 第 1 頁:LTE系統中FFT的實現
- 第 2 頁:內循環
本文導航
非常好我支持^.^
(2) 100%
不好我反對
(0) 0%
相關閱讀:
- [電子說] HOLTEK新推出BH66F2475連續血糖監測MCU 2023-10-24
- [控制/MCU] Holtek新推出HT67F2452紅外線驅動A/D與LCD型Flash MCU 2023-10-23
- [電子說] 如何理解FFT中的頻譜泄露效應? 2023-10-23
- [電子說] LTE系統TDD無線幀結構特點 2023-10-21
- [電子說] 為什么會造成頻譜泄露?如何理解FFT中的頻譜泄露效應? 2023-10-20
- [電子說] 與4G相比,5G如何降低功耗呢? 2023-10-19
- [電子說] EaseFilter File System文件I/O監視器 2023-10-18
- [電子說] 直方圖測試模數轉換器(ADC)介紹 2023-10-17
( 發表人:小蘭 )